World Bank Says Middle East, North Africa Need Education Reform

A new World Bank report says countries in the Middle East and North Africa need to overhaul their education systems in order to thrive in the new global economy. The report says the region has made important progress in improving literacy and closing the gender gap, but needs to shift the emphasis to teaching key skills such as problem-solving, critical thinking and languages. Gates Says Al-Qaida Expanding in N. Africa

U.S. Defense Secretary Robert Gates says the al-Qaida terrorist network is expanding in North Africa, through a loose network of groups that share its ideology.

World Bank Warns Of Water-Resources Crisis

The World Bank has urged governments in the Middle East and North Africa to speed up improvements to water resources.
